industrial foam converters are specialized machines used to convert raw foam materials into custom shapes and sizes for various industries. These machines are equipped with cutting-edge technology that allows them to quickly and accurately cut, shape, and mold foam materials to meet the specific requirements of manufacturers. From packaging materials to automotive parts, industrial foam converters play a crucial role in a wide range of industries.

One of the key benefits of industrial foam converters is their ability to increase efficiency and reduce waste in the manufacturing process. Traditionally, cutting foam materials by hand or using manual tools can be time-consuming and result in uneven cuts and shapes. This can lead to a significant amount of waste and rework, ultimately costing manufacturers time and money. industrial foam converters, on the other hand, are able to precisely cut foam materials with minimal waste, resulting in higher quality products and increased production output.

Another advantage of industrial foam converters is their versatility and flexibility. These machines are capable of working with a wide range of foam materials, including polyethylene, polyurethane, and polystyrene, among others. This versatility allows manufacturers to use industrial foam converters for a variety of applications, from creating custom packaging materials to producing intricate foam components for electronics and medical devices.

In addition to their efficiency and versatility, industrial foam converters also offer manufacturers the ability to create complex shapes and designs that would be difficult or impossible to achieve with traditional cutting methods. By using computer-aided design (CAD) software, manufacturers can create precise digital models of the desired foam product, which can then be converted into physical prototypes using an industrial foam converter. This level of precision and customizability is invaluable for industries that require intricate and highly specialized foam components.

While industrial foam converters have certainly revolutionized the manufacturing industry, it is important to note that their adoption is not without challenges. The initial investment in an industrial foam converter can be significant, and manufacturers must carefully consider factors such as production volume, material requirements, and design complexity before making the decision to invest in this technology. Additionally, specialized training and maintenance are required to operate and maintain industrial foam converters effectively, further adding to the overall cost of implementation.
